The Scarf Market continues to evolve as consumers increasingly prioritize both fashion and sustainability. Scarves remain among the most versatile accessories in the global apparel industry, offering style, comfort, and functionality across multiple seasons. As environmental awareness grows, consumers are seeking products made from responsibly sourced materials, encouraging manufacturers to adopt sustainable production practices. Combined with changing fashion preferences and rising digital retail adoption, these trends are supporting strong market growth.
The rising demand for sustainable fashion accessories is significantly influencing market development. Consumers are increasingly drawn to products made from organic cotton, recycled fibers, bamboo fabrics, and eco-friendly materials. This trend is encouraging brands to invest in sustainable sourcing and transparent supply chains while developing collections that appeal to environmentally conscious buyers.
Fashion remains a major market driver. Scarves are widely appreciated for their ability to add elegance, color, and individuality to outfits. Designers continue introducing innovative patterns, seasonal collections, and premium materials that cater to changing consumer preferences. Social media platforms and fashion influencers have amplified awareness of styling techniques, contributing to increased product demand.
The premium segment is witnessing notable expansion as consumers seek higher-quality accessories with superior craftsmanship. Luxury scarves made from silk, cashmere, and designer fabrics are particularly popular among consumers who value exclusivity and durability. These premium products often command higher prices while supporting strong brand loyalty.
Technology is also playing a growing role in market expansion. Digital retail channels enable consumers to access global fashion brands, compare products, and discover emerging trends. Personalized recommendations, virtual shopping experiences, and targeted advertising are helping companies improve customer engagement and drive online sales.
Regional markets exhibit unique growth dynamics. Europe continues to lead due to its strong fashion culture and established luxury brands. North America benefits from robust consumer spending and growing demand for premium accessories. Meanwhile, Asia-Pacific is emerging as a major growth hub due to urbanization, rising disposable incomes, and increasing interest in global fashion trends.
Manufacturers are also focusing on customization and limited-edition collections to attract consumers seeking unique products. Personalized scarves featuring monograms, custom designs, and exclusive patterns are gaining popularity among fashion-conscious buyers.
Looking ahead, sustainability, innovation, and digital transformation are expected to remain key themes shaping the future of the Scarf Market. Companies that successfully combine environmental responsibility with fashion-forward designs will likely enjoy strong growth opportunities in the coming years.
